This role is for a Senior Software Engineer - Knowledge Graph, responsible for maintaining data quality, integration, and development of the knowledge graph platform, a vital asset that consolidates diverse drug discovery and gene biology data.
Responsibilities:
- Own data quality: Define and enforce data validation, provenance tracking, and quality metrics across all data sources in the graph.
- Integrate data sources: Collaborate with internal and external data providers to ingest, normalize, and harmonize heterogeneous biomedical datasets.
- Maintain the knowledge graph: Manage the Neo4j schema, data modeling, and pipeline reliability.
- Prepare data for AI/analytics: Ensure graph data supports AI and analytics use cases, including the Blindspot Analysis.
- Collaborate cross-functionally: Work with research scientists, data scientists, and engineers to align scientific needs with reliable data solutions.
Must Haves:
- Strong Python skills for data engineering and pipeline development.
- Hands-on experience with Neo4j (Cypher, schema design, query optimization).
- Proven experience integrating multiple heterogeneous biomedical data sources.
- Deep understanding of data quality practices in production environments.
- Experience resolving schema, identifier, and consistency issues directly with data providers.
- Familiarity with biomedical standards and identifiers (UniProt, Ensembl, ChEMBL, etc.).
- Strong communication skills with cross-functional scientific and technical teams.
Nice to Haves:
- Experience in pharma, biotech, or academic drug discovery.
- Advanced degree (MSc/PhD) in a relevant field.
- Familiarity with graph ML, embeddings, or search/retrieval concepts.
